PV(1)				   WaoN Manual				   PV(1)

NAME
     WaoN-pv - yet-another phase vocoder

SYNOPSIS
     pv [option ...]

DESCRIPTION
     WaoN-pv  is  yet-another  phase  vocoder with which you can time-strech and
     pitch-shift a sound file.

OPTIONS
     -h, --help
	    print this help.

     -v, --version
	    print version information.

     OPTIONS FOR FILES

     -i, --input
	    input file (default: stdin)

     -o, --output
	    output file in flac (default: play audio by ao)

     FFT OPTIONS

     -n     FFT data number (default: 2048)

     -w --window
	    0 no window
	    1 parzen window
	    2 welch window
	    3 hanning window (default)
	    4 hamming window
	    5 blackman window
	    6 steeper 30-dB/octave rolloff window

     PHASE-VOCODER OPTIONS

     -hop   hop number (default: 256)

     -rate  synthesize rate; larger is faster (default: 1.0)

     -pitch
	    pitch shift. +1/-1 is half-note up/down (default: 0)

     -scheme
	    give the number for PV scheme
	    0 : interactive PV with curses (default)
	    1 : conventional PV
	    2 : PV by complex arithmetics with fixed hops
	    3 : Puckette's loose-locking PV
	    4 : Puckette's loose-locking PV by complex with fixed hops
	    5 : PV with fixed hops by Ellis
	    6 : PV in freq. domain
	    7 : plain superimpose (no-FFT)

KEY BINDINGS IN CURSES MODE (with -scheme 0, the default)
     SPACE	  : play / stop

     < >	  : set loop range

     [{ }]	  : expand the loop range

     L, l	  : phase-lock on / off

     W, w	  : change window

     H, h	  : hop-size up / down

     UP / DOWN	  : pitch up / down

     LEFT / RIGHT : pitch up / down

     R, r, HOME   : reset parameters

     N, n	  : toggle for no-FFT mode

     Q, q	  : quit
